How they compare

Uganda currently reports 30.03 billion current US$ against 25.40 billion current US$ in Bahrain, a difference of 4.63 billion current US$.

That makes Uganda's figure about 1.2 times Bahrain's.

The two have swapped places 9 times across 41 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Bahrain ahead.

Globally, Bahrain ranks 99th and Uganda ranks 96th of 184 countries.

Adjusted net national income is GNI minus consumption of fixed capital and natural resources depletion.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
